Typhoon Bualoi has caused severe damage in Vietnam, killing 11 people, 17 missing, and 33 injured. According to the weather agency of Vietnam, Bualoi had moved along the country’s northern central coastline before making landfall early this morning, causing waves as high as eight meters. The country’s disaster management agency said 17 fishermen were missing after huge waves hit two fishing boats off Quang Tri province, while another fishing boat lost contact during the storm. The government had evacuated more than 28 thousand 500 people, while hundreds of flights were cancelled or delayed as four airports in central provinces were closed.
